As we mentioned last week, the first few weeks of the Bundesliga season have seen some surprising results, creating a table that looks like its been tossed on its head. That trend continued this weekend when Borussia Dortmund beat Schalke 3-1 for the first time since 2007 in their local derby.

Poland head coach Franciszek Smuda has called on 23 players for the upcoming friendlies against the United States and Ecuador as his side continues their preparations as co-hosts of the 2012 European Championship.

The squad is led up top by Euzebiusz Smolarek, whose 19 goals in 45 international games include six in 2010 FIFA World Cup qualifying - the second most in Europe - and eight in qualifying for the 2008 European Championship.
